1. Prioritize Local Markets and Fairs

One of the most effective ways to support local craft cooperatives is by attending local markets and fairs. These events often showcase the work of various artisans and craftspeople, allowing you to buy directly from the source. By purchasing items at these venues, you not only support local businesses but also encourage the growth of the cooperative movement in your area. Additionally, markets often feature a diverse range of products, providing a unique shopping experience that can’t be replicated by mass-produced goods.

5. Consider Membership or Donations

Many local craft cooperatives rely on community support to operate and grow. Consider becoming a member or making a donation to your favorite cooperative. Membership often comes with exclusive benefits, such as discounts or early access to new products. Donations can help fund workshops, materials, and community outreach efforts. By investing in these cooperatives, you are directly contributing to their sustainability and success.
